These soft, fluffy pumpkin cupcakes are infused with warm spices and topped with tangy cream cheese frosting. Made with pureed pumpkin and baked to moist perfection, they're a cozy fall dessert.

Ingredients
  

Pumpkin Cupcakes

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our 240g
  • 0.5 cup granulated sugar 100g
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 0.75 teaspoon salt
  • 2 teaspoons pumpkin pie spice
  • 2 teaspoons ground ginger
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1 can pureed pumpkin 425g/15-ounce
  • 1 cup vegetable oil 240mL
  • 1 cup packed light brown sugar 220g
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
  • 0.66 cup unsalted butter softened, 151g
  • 8 oz cream cheese room temperature, 225g
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ract for frosting
  • 0.125 teaspoon salt for frosting
  • 4 cups powdered sugar sifted, 480g

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 350°F and line muffin tins with cupcake liners.
  • In a large bowl, whisk together flour, granulated sugar, baking powder, baking soda, salt, pumpkin pie spice, ginger, and cinnamon.
  • In another bowl, combine pureed pumpkin, vegetable oil, brown sugar, eggs, and vanilla extract until smooth.
  • Add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ients and stir just until combined with no dry streaks.
  • Fill each cupcake liner about ⅔ full with batter and bake for 20 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
  • Let cupcakes cool in the pan for 5–10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
  • For frosting, beat butter until creamy, then add cream cheese and beat until smooth. Mix in vanilla and salt. Gradually add powdered sugar and beat until fluffy. Pipe onto cooled cupcakes.

Notes

Let cupcakes cool completely before frosting. Store frosted cupcakes in the fridge for up to 4 days or freeze unfrosted for longer storage.
